is a dam in Wichita, Kansas. The dam is owned by Caprock Industries (private). It impounds the Ladder Creek -tr.

The dam stands 29 feet tall and stretches 1,270 feet across, has a maximum storage capacity of 406 acre-feet, and collects water from a drainage area of 0 square miles. Completed in 1998, the structure is 28 years old.

This dam has a low hazard potential classification, meaning that failure would cause minimal damage, limited primarily to the dam owner's property, with no expected loss of life. The most recent inspection on record was 05/28/1998. That was over 27 years ago.
